Handover: incremental rebuilds on Lintpress. Cache invalidation is content-hash based; don't touch the manifest by hand. If a rebuild loops, clear the stale-marker table and requeue. Full rebuilds only as last resort — 40 min. Deploy freeze Fridays. Priya owns the diffing layer now. Everything else, including the debugging checklist, is documented on this page:

wiki page, tahaf-tajog: https://jira.ordindyn.corp/pipeline

**Ticket #: Vault locked after image-slimming rollout — Ostrel Build Team**

While trimming the base image for the Calverno deploy pipeline, we removed the vault client's helper binaries, which caused three failed unseal attempts and locked the secrets vault. Functionality is restored in the slimmed image, but the vault remains locked pending manual recovery. Per policy, a reviewer must confirm the lockout cause before unsealing. To proceed, unseal with the passphrase provided below.

unlock words, bahap-bajof: sorax-giliel-quenwyn

Discussed the recurring failures in the settlement test suite. Root cause appears to be a race between the ledger fixture setup and the mock clearing house, which occasionally returns before the fixture commits. Agreed to add an explicit readiness gate rather than increasing timeouts, since timeouts have masked real regressions twice. Quarantining the three worst offenders until the fix lands; they must not stay quarantined past next sprint. The follow-up work and the quarantine list are owned by one engineer.

named custodian: Brivan Eliath Quenox Frador

Release checklist — Catalogue Import (Lumenstack 4.2): Before tagging, verify the Bramwell Library fixture set imports cleanly with all 14,000 MARC records and that duplicate-detection flags are logged, not dropped. Run the dry-run importer twice; the second pass must report zero new rows. If counts drift, halt and page the data team rather than re-running. Record the exact importer build used so future maintainers can reproduce the run. The verified build token is listed below.

pipeline stamp: htk3_cc5